Specifying value of each pixel in a superpixel

I could specify superpixels for an image an their properties.

  L = superpixels(A, 200);
    K=regionprops(L, 'PixelIdxList');

I know that mean intensity value of each superpixel could be specified as follows:

K=regionprops(L, 'MeanIntensity')

The question is how it is possible to specify values of all pixels within a superpixel?

The syntax for getting a list of all pixel values within each label is K = regionprops(L, A, 'PixelValues'). But this only works for grey-value A.

The simplest solution is to iterate over the channels, and call the above function for each channel:

A = imread('~/tmp/boat.tiff'); % whatever RGB image
L = superpixels(A, 200);

n = size(A,3); % number of channels, typically 3
K = cell(max(L(:)),n);
for ii=1:n
   tmp = regionprops(L, A(:,:,ii), 'PixelValues');
   K(:,ii) = {tmp.PixelValues};
end

We now have a cell array K that contains the values for each labeled pixel: K{lab,1} is the set of values for the pixels labeled lab, for the first channel.

The following code collates the components of each pixel into a single array:

K2 = cell(size(K,1),1);
for ii=1:numel(K2)
   K2{ii} = [K{ii,:}];
end

Now K2 contains RGB arrays of data: K{lab} is a Nx3 matrix with RGB values for each of the N pixels labeled lab.
